Bytecode Viewer Bundles – The Application Bundle

Drag & Drop leaves the associated files of Bytecode Viewer application. Normally, it is thought that all the associated files of a application is saved in the one folder but it is not so. Bytecode Viewer supported files & preference files are saved in other location than the Bytecode Viewer Package folder. So you need to get all these files deleted manually. Deleting all the left overs of Bytecode Viewer is not that easy, you need to find all the location where Bytecode Viewer has saved the files. Some of the location where Bytecode Viewer would have saved the files are ~/Library/Preferences/[] ~/Library/Application Support/[]

Using Finder the remove the Bytecode Viewer Application Bundles & Additional Files

To Manually uninstall Bytecode Viewer & all associated files
  • Start the Activity monitor to look for the processes running, if you find the Bytecode Viewer application process running then quit it, make sure that Bytecode Viewer processes is not running.
  • Start finder to look for the Bytecode Viewer name.
  • Searching "Bytecode Viewer" vs "Contents"
  • Delete all files and folders related to the Bytecode Viewer app.
  • A reboot might be necessary to completely remove some apps.
